What companies run services between Porto Turistico Di Roma, Italy and Pisa, Italy?

Trenitalia Frecce operates a train from Roma Tiburtina to Pisa Centrale once daily. Tickets cost €45–90 and the journey takes 2h 13m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Fiumicino Aeroporto T3 to Pisa 5 times a week. Tickets cost €21–40 and the journey takes 4h 35m.
